4 Simple Steps To Bring A Taste Of Italy Into Your Home
-
Shop for fresh ingredients: Italy is famous for its high-quality ingredients, so make sure to visit your local farmers market or specialty store to get the best produce, meats, and cheeses.
-
Simplify your cooking routine: Italian cooking is all about simplicity, so focus on using a few high-quality ingredients and avoiding complicated recipes.
-
Explore regional flavors: Italy's diverse regions offer a wealth of flavors and specialties, so take the time to explore these differences and incorporate them into your cooking routine.
-
Create a cozy atmosphere: Italian cooking is not just about the food; it's also about cre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. Make sure to set the mood with candles, soft music, and a beautifully set table.
